What does cryonics mean?
noun: the freezing of a seriously ill or recently deceased person to stop tissues from decomposing; the body is preserved until new medical cures are developed that might bring the person back to life.
“cryonics is more science fiction than serious science”
Definition from WordNet, Princeton University.
